Distance to transmitters:
- Hemel Hempstead - 6.9km 4.3 miles
- Sandy Heath - 51.7km 32.1 miles
- Sudbury - 88.5km 55.0 miles
- Dover - 129.5km 80.4 miles
- Bluebell Hill - 73.7km 45.8 miles
